The students majoring in food and nutrition science served as panel. 1. The above mentioned nine kinds of confectionery were evaluated with a nine-graded hedonic scale, and obtained results were shown in Fig. 1. Putting the results of 1985 and 1986 together, "karukan", "hiyoko", and "hakatasenbei" were the best preferences. "Bontan-zuke" was the worst. 2. Preference of "karukan" was evaluated with a nine-graded food action rating scale. Results of evaluation was expressed in Table 2,and "karukan" was indicated to situate in the middle of likes and dislikes. 3. Five kinds of "karukan" (AO, FU, ED, AK, NA) were evaluated with a sevengraded quality judgement scale. Results of evaluation on appearance, color, odor, palatability, sweetness, and comprehensive taste of the "karukan" samples with the scale were shown in Table 3 and 4. Results of judgment of allcomprehensive ranking were given in Table 5 and 6.
